The Church of Saint James the Elder in Petrovice stands as Prague-Petrovice's oldest monument, dating back to the second half of the 13th century. Initially Romanesque, it evolved into an early Gothic structure and is protected for its historical significance. Notable for its architectural evolution and community role, the church has undergone several transformations over the centuries.

The earliest parish records date to Charles IV's reign, a time marked by cultural and architectural development in Prague. Bohemia transitioned from Romanesque to Gothic architecture during this period, reflecting broader Central European trends. The church likely began construction then, embodying both styles.

Architecturally, it started as Romanesque but soon incorporated early Gothic features. By the mid-18th century, substantial reconstruction added baroque elements like a bell tower and sacristy. In 1910, restoration efforts aimed to restore its original Gothic character by removing these modifications, including replacing a baroque dome with a slender four-sided spire.

Throughout history, various administrators have overseen its transformations. Notably, in 1776, a bell tower was established within the newly constructed western belfry. By 1910, efforts were made to return it to its Gothic roots. These changes reflect broader historical trends and local community needs.

Key events include its role as a community focal point. Recently, it has hosted unique cultural activities like an annual nativity scene created at the beginning of the 21st century. This display features local parishioners and their families, both living and deceased, set against photographs depicting Petrovice and Horní Měcholupy landmarks. In 2016, Cardinal Dominik Duka consecrated the newly completed parish center Camino adjacent to the church, enhancing its community role.

Architectural development

The church was originally built in the late Romanesque style but evolved into an early Gothic structure. In the mid-18th century, it underwent significant reconstruction, including the addition of a baroque bell tower and sacristy. A major restoration in 1910 aimed to restore its Gothic appearance by removing baroque elements.
